Course content

• Introduction to Legal Traditions and Comparative Law
• Historical Development of International Legal Systems
• Common Law and Civil Law Traditions
• Islamic Law and Its Influence on International Legal Frameworks
• Customary Law and Indigenous Legal Systems
• International Human Rights Law and Legal Traditions
• The Role of Treaties and Conventions in Shaping Legal Traditions
• Legal Pluralism and Globalization
• Case Studies in Cross-Cultural Legal Disputes
• Contemporary Challenges in Harmonizing Legal Traditions
